as a side note regarding duet 3 (6hc): when an end switch - let's say y (active low) is disconnected for some reason and i try to home y the printer hangs - no motion related commands are accepted afterwords until it is reset by power cycling duet + raspberry (emergency stop, reset, and (at least sometimes) a reset of the hc6 does not unhang the printer).
Unplugging a Normally Closed switch (the switch pulls the pin to ground when NOT triggered) is equivalent of a broken wire. This should, and does, cause the switch to "look triggered all the time" and the machine will not move on a homing sequence.
It shouldn't hang like you describe... although, I've noticed similar hangs when homing moves don't complete on D3+Pi. Reset the firmware does not fix it, which makes me assume the Pi is still 'out-of-sync' waiting for that move.
